A day-active, omnivorous lizard from the Afrotropic region, reaching 157 mm snout to vent.
Also called African Redhead Agama, Peter's Rock Agama, Peters's Rock Agama.

Ofori et al. 2018: "this species is a generalist insectivore, preying mainly on spiders, grasshoppers, beetles, ants and termites, butterflies and moths, and flies (Harris, 1964; Anibaldi et al., 1998; Akani et al., 2013). Secondarily, they also consume other types of invertebrates, small vertebrates, and even plant materials (Chapman and Chapman, 1964; Yeboah, 1982). Studies have also shown that animals in urban areas opportunistically consume anthropogenic food items due to their ease of access, relative abundance, high caloric energy levels, and ease of digestion (Murray et al., 2015; Reher et al., 2016; Cronk and Pillay, 2018).", omnivorous (Pauwels et al. 2017), mostly ants (Spawls et al. 2023)

Feeding
A prey item should be no wider than the space between the animal's eyes.
Widely used across reptile husbandry references. The stated reason is that the gap approximates the width of the throat, so wider prey is associated with impaction. This is established practice, not a measurement.
